/******************************************************************************
* Define the strings used in our USB descriptors.
*/
const void *const usb_strings[] = {
[USB_STR_DESC] = usb_string_desc,
[USB_STR_VENDOR] = USB_STRING_DESC("Google Inc."),
[USB_STR_PRODUCT] = USB_STRING_DESC("Sweetberry"),
[USB_STR_SERIALNO] = USB_STRING_DESC("1234-a"),
[USB_STR_VERSION] = USB_STRING_DESC(CROS_EC_VERSION32),
[USB_STR_I2C_NAME] = USB_STRING_DESC("I2C"),
[USB_STR_CONSOLE_NAME] = USB_STRING_DESC("Sweetberry EC Shell"),
[USB_STR_UPDATE_NAME] = USB_STRING_DESC("Firmware update"),
};
BUILD_ASSERT(ARRAY_SIZE(usb_strings) == USB_STR_COUNT);
/* USB power interface. */
USB_POWER_CONFIG(sweetberry_power, USB_IFACE_POWER, USB_EP_POWER);
struct dwc_usb usb_ctl = {
.ep = {
&ep0_ctl,
&ep_console_ctl,
&usb_update_ep_ctl,
&sweetberry_power_ep_ctl,
&i2c_usb__ep_ctl,
},
.speed = USB_SPEED_FS,
.phy_type = USB_PHY_ULPI,
.dma_en = 1,
.irq = STM32_IRQ_OTG_HS,
};
/* I2C ports */
const struct i2c_port_t i2c_ports[] = {
{"i2c1", I2C_PORT_0, 400,
GPIO_I2C1_SCL, GPIO_I2C1_SDA},
{"i2c2", I2C_PORT_1, 400,
GPIO_I2C2_SCL, GPIO_I2C2_SDA},
{"i2c3", I2C_PORT_2, 400,
GPIO_I2C3_SCL, GPIO_I2C3_SDA},
{"fmpi2c4", FMPI2C_PORT_3, 900,
GPIO_FMPI2C_SCL, GPIO_FMPI2C_SDA},
};
const unsigned int i2c_ports_used = ARRAY_SIZE(i2c_ports);
int usb_i2c_board_is_enabled(void) { return 1; }
#define GPIO_SET_HS(bank, number) \
(STM32_GPIO_OSPEEDR(GPIO_##bank) |= (0x3 << ((number) * 2)))
void board_config_post_gpio_init(void)
{
/* We use MCO2 clock passthrough to provide a clock to USB HS */
gpio_config_module(MODULE_MCO, 1);
/* GPIO PC9 to high speed */
GPIO_SET_HS(C, 9);
if (usb_ctl.phy_type == USB_PHY_ULPI)
gpio_set_level(GPIO_USB_MUX_SEL, 0);
else
gpio_set_level(GPIO_USB_MUX_SEL, 1);
/* Set USB GPIO to high speed */
GPIO_SET_HS(A, 11);
GPIO_SET_HS(A, 12);
GPIO_SET_HS(C, 3);
GPIO_SET_HS(C, 2);
GPIO_SET_HS(C, 0);
GPIO_SET_HS(A, 5);
GPIO_SET_HS(B, 5);
GPIO_SET_HS(B, 13);
GPIO_SET_HS(B, 12);
GPIO_SET_HS(B, 2);
GPIO_SET_HS(B, 10);
GPIO_SET_HS(B, 1);
GPIO_SET_HS(B, 0);
GPIO_SET_HS(A, 3);
/* Set I2C GPIO to HS */
GPIO_SET_HS(B, 6);
GPIO_SET_HS(B, 7);
GPIO_SET_HS(F, 1);
GPIO_SET_HS(F, 0);
GPIO_SET_HS(A, 8);
GPIO_SET_HS(B, 4);
GPIO_SET_HS(C, 6);
GPIO_SET_HS(C, 7);
}
static void board_init(void)
{
uint8_t tmp;
/* i2c 0 has a tendancy to get wedged. TODO(nsanders): why? */
i2c_xfer(0, 0, NULL, 0, &tmp, 1);
}
DECLARE_HOOK(HOOK_INIT, board_init, HOOK_PRIO_DEFAULT);
